Transaction 3010445edccb7aff7fcfed515427e5c5216defdb38bf0f3e49bdbcf5b0b46622

13 Input
2 Outputs
  • 3010445edccb7aff7fcfed515427e5c5216defdb38bf0f3e49bdbcf5b0b46622:0
  • value  21286193
    address  1Lt3vcGxRRsXF8KgMh69RGbUqCDFaoHzr6
  • 3010445edccb7aff7fcfed515427e5c5216defdb38bf0f3e49bdbcf5b0b46622:1
  • value  1000049
    address  3F1cSBCif7FuAB212soicu9cDZm5xsbw14